In 1929, Fritz Zwicky published his famous paper “On the redshift of spectral lines” right after the discovery of Hubble’s famous cosmological redshift law. Zwicky showed that the Hubble law is based on ordinary gravitational interaction between the passing light rays on the one hand and the randomly moving galaxies and their clusters that are being negotiated on the other.
